How To Write Resume For Animal Hospital Clerk

  • Highlight your relevant skills and experience in your resume objective or summary statement.
  • Showcase your compassion for animals and your understanding of veterinary procedures in your experience section.
  • Emphasize your ability to work effectively in a fast-paced and demanding environment.
  • Include any certifications or training you have completed in the field.

Essential Experience Highlights for a Strong Animal Hospital Clerk Resume

To enhance the impact of your Animal Hospital Clerk resume, focus on these essential experience highlights. These examples can help you craft a more compelling and effective job application.
  • Processed and verified animal medical records, ensuring accuracy and completeness.
  • Scheduled appointments, maintained patient files, and provided timely and accurate information to clients.
  • Assisted veterinarians and technicians with animal handling, restraint, and basic medical procedures.
  • Managed animal inventory, including ordering supplies, maintaining stock levels, and ensuring proper storage and handling.
  • Communicated effectively with clients, resolving inquiries and concerns promptly and providing excellent customer service.
  • Maintained a clean and hygienic environment by cleaning and disinfecting animal examination rooms, surgical suites, and equipment.
  • Processed insurance claims and invoices, ensuring accurate billing and timely payments.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’s) For Animal Hospital Clerk

  • What are the primary duties of an Animal Hospital Clerk?

    Animal Hospital Clerks are responsible for providing administrative and support services in animal hospitals and veterinary clinics. Their duties include processing medical records, scheduling appointments, managing animal inventory, communicating with clients, and assisting veterinarians and technicians with animal care.

  • What qualifications are required to become an Animal Hospital Clerk?

    Most Animal Hospital Clerk positions require at least a high school diploma or equivalent qualification. Some employers may prefer candidates with experience in animal care or veterinary medicine, or with relevant certifications in veterinary technology or animal handling.

  • What are the career prospects for Animal Hospital Clerks?

    Animal Hospital Clerks can advance their careers by gaining additional experience and qualifications. With experience, they may take on more responsibilities, such as managing the reception area or assisting with surgical procedures. Some Animal Hospital Clerks may also pursue further education to become veterinary technicians or licensed veterinary nurses.

  • What is the average salary for an Animal Hospital Clerk?

    The average salary for an Animal Hospital Clerk in the United States is around $35,000 per year, according to the Bureau of Labor Statistics. Salaries may vary depending on experience, location, and employer.

  • What are the benefits of working as an Animal Hospital Clerk?

    Animal Hospital Clerks enjoy a variety of benefits, including the opportunity to work with animals, flexible work hours, and the chance to make a difference in the lives of animals and their owners.
